What is the Cell Lysis and Disruption Market?

The cell lysis and disruption market represents a critical segment of the global life sciences tools industry focused on technologies used to break open cells for extraction of intracellular components such as proteins, nucleic acids, enzymes, and organelles. These technologies play a foundational role across biotechnology research, pharmaceutical development, molecular diagnostics, and proteomics workflows.

Cell lysis and disruption techniques are widely applied across applications including recombinant protein production, gene expression analysis, downstream bioprocessing, and nucleic acid purification. As demand for biologics manufacturing and precision medicine research continues to expand globally, adoption of advanced cell disruption technologies is increasing rapidly across laboratory and industrial environments.

According to industry analysis, the global cell lysis and disruption market was valued at USD 4.6 billion in 2021 and is projected to reach USD 10.1 billion by 2030, growing at a CAGR of 9.2% from 2022 to 2030. Increasing investments in genomics research, expansion of biologics pipelines, and rising adoption of molecular diagnostics platforms are major contributors supporting long-term market growth.

Cell Lysis and Disruption Market Trends
Rising Demand for Biopharmaceutical Production

One of the most important trends shaping the cell lysis and disruption market is the rapid expansion of biologics manufacturing. Recombinant proteins, monoclonal antibodies, and viral vectors require efficient cell disruption technologies to enable downstream purification processes.

This increasing production demand is strengthening adoption of automated and high-efficiency lysis platforms across pharmaceutical manufacturing environments.

Growth in Genomics and Proteomics Research

Advancements in genomics and proteomics technologies are increasing reliance on cell disruption tools capable of preserving biomolecule integrity. High-throughput sequencing workflows depend heavily on reliable extraction of nucleic acids and intracellular proteins.

As precision medicine initiatives expand globally, these research applications continue to support market growth.

Increasing Adoption of Automated Sample Preparation Systems

Laboratories are increasingly adopting automated sample preparation platforms to improve workflow reproducibility and reduce manual processing time. Integration of automated lysis solutions within molecular biology pipelines is improving operational efficiency across research environments.

These automation trends are expected to support sustained market expansion during the forecast period.

Expansion of Biotechnology Research Infrastructure in Emerging Economies

Emerging economies across Asia-Pacific are investing heavily in biotechnology infrastructure development. Expansion of academic laboratories and pharmaceutical manufacturing facilities is supporting increased adoption of cell disruption technologies worldwide.

Cell Lysis and Disruption Market Dynamics
Market Drivers

One of the primary drivers of the cell lysis and disruption market is the increasing demand for recombinant protein production across pharmaceutical and biotechnology industries. Efficient cell disruption remains essential for isolating therapeutic biomolecules used in biologics manufacturing workflows.

Another major growth factor is the rapid expansion of molecular diagnostics technologies. Extraction of DNA and RNA from biological samples requires optimized lysis protocols supporting reliable analytical performance.

Additionally, increasing government funding for genomics research and life-science innovation initiatives worldwide is strengthening adoption of advanced cell disruption platforms.

Market Restraints

Despite strong growth prospects, high capital investment requirements associated with advanced homogenizers and ultrasonic disruptors remain a challenge limiting adoption among smaller laboratories.

Furthermore, variability in lysis efficiency depending on cell type and protocol complexity can create operational challenges in research workflows.

Market Opportunities

Growing investments in personalized medicine and targeted therapeutics present major opportunities for manufacturers developing next-generation cell disruption technologies.

In addition, increasing adoption of enzyme-based lysis kits and microfluidic sample preparation platforms is expected to create long-term opportunities across high-throughput molecular research environments.
